一种数据包的规则匹配方法及装置

    公开(公告)号:CN103560958B

    公开(公告)日:2017-01-18

    申请号:CN201310493721.6

    申请日:2013-10-18

    Abstract: 本发明属于通信技术领域,公开了一种数据包的规则匹配方法及装置,该方法包括:利用在多个包获取线程中确定的一个包获取线程捕获接收的数据包;利用在确定的包获取线程绑定的多个协议处理线程中确定的一个协议处理线程获取数据包的协议信息;其中,确定的包获取线程和确定的协议处理线程为根据负载均衡算法确定的;将协议信息分别发送至确定的协议处理线程绑定的至少两个数据包处理线程中;每个数据包处理线程分别利用协议信息与对应加载的至少一个规则条目进行匹配,将匹配出的优先级最高的规则条目作为与数据包匹配的规则条目。本发明通过实现负载均衡加强了网络数据处理能力,克服了现有技术中负载均衡受流量的不均衡性和突发性的影响。

    一种流表转换方法和装置

    公开(公告)号:CN103259718B

    公开(公告)日:2016-12-28

    申请号:CN201310135991.X

    申请日:2013-04-18

    Abstract: 本发明的实施例提供一种流表转换方法和装置,涉及网络技术领域,在软件到硬件实现过程中控制器无需适应硬件的下发规则,减小了控制器的负担和管理开销。该方法具体包括:在控制和转发相分离的网络设备架构中,将软件形式的多级流表等价转换成软件形式的单级流表;其中,所述单级流表是单表多域的;根据硬件所实现的多级流表将所述单级流表拆分成对应的硬件形式的多级流表。本发明应用于流表转换中。

    一种预测用户离网的方法及装置

    公开(公告)号:CN106022505A

    公开(公告)日:2016-10-12

    申请号:CN201610278651.6

    申请日:2016-04-28

    Inventor: 董雯霞 林程勇

    Abstract: 本发明实施例提供一种预测用户离网的方法及装置,涉及移动通信和数据挖掘技术领域,对用户离网情况进行提前预测,以便在用户离网之前,采用必要的挽留措施,降低电信运营商的经济损失。所述方法包括:获取至少一个用户中每个用户的多维度行为数据,将用户的多维度行为数据作为预设的预测模型的输入变量,用于确定用户是否离网的变量作为预测模型的输出变量,对所述预测模型进行模型训练,根据训练后的所述预测模型,对待测用户进行离网预测。

    一种多级流表查找方法和装置

    公开(公告)号:CN103354522B

    公开(公告)日:2016-08-10

    申请号:CN201310269726.0

    申请日:2013-06-28

    Abstract: 本发明实施例提供一种多级流表查找方法和装置,以增强流表匹配域配置的灵活性。所述方法包括:在收到数据包时抽取数据包的匹配信息;根据流表匹配域配置信息,从数据包的匹配信息中选择关键字;以关键字为查找关键字,从多级流表中第一级流表开始,查找所述多级流表中每一级流表的匹配域进行查找关键字与匹配域的匹配;若当前一级流表的匹配域匹配完成,则执行相应的指令,若当前一级流表不是最后一级流表或者有执行动作的指令时,则执行相应的动作。本发明实施例提供的方法中,其流表匹配域配置信息可以通过软件配置,因此,固定的匹配域变成了可变化的匹配域,增强了流表匹配域的灵活性,也减少了因为更改匹配域时修改硬件逻辑带来的成本。

    一种故障根因分析方法和分析设备

    公开(公告)号:CN105471659A

    公开(公告)日:2016-04-06

    申请号:CN201510990742.8

    申请日:2015-12-25

    CPC classification number: H04L41/064 H04L41/024 H04L41/0631

    Abstract: 本发明公开了一种故障根因分析方法和分析设备,涉及数据挖掘和网络管理领域,以解决现有故障根因分析过程中,需要采用大量的人力和时间来分析网络日志,导致的故障根因分析效率较低,不能及时排除网络故障的问题。方法包括:确定网络设备的故障时间点;获取网络设备在第一时间段内产生的第一日志信息集;第一日志信息集包含M类日志信息;根据预设分析策略对M类日志信息中每类日志信息进行分析,获取M类日志信息中的N类根因日志;根因日志为:网络设备发生故障时产生的日志信息,M≥N≥1,预设分析策略为:预先确定的所述网络设备故障发生时日志发生的规律;根据N类根因日志确定网络设备发生故障的原因。

    报文处理方法及设备、系统

    公开(公告)号:CN103220225B

    公开(公告)日:2015-07-08

    申请号:CN201210157767.6

    申请日:2012-05-21

    CPC classification number: H04L45/38 H04L45/021

    Abstract: 本申请提供一种报文处理方法及设备、系统。本申请使得能够根据添加的所述第一流表表项对接收到的报文进行及时处理,实现了重要性较高的流进行及时处理,能够缓解现有技术中由于流表表项资源被占满而导致的转发设备无法将新的流表表项添加到流表中的问题,从而提高了报文处理的可靠性。

    用户管理设备、BNG、BNG用户上线方法及系统

    公开(公告)号:CN104521320A

    公开(公告)日:2015-04-15

    申请号:CN201380000933.4

    申请日:2013-07-31

    Inventor: 林程勇

    CPC classification number: H04W48/18 H04W12/06 H04W48/16 H04W88/16

    Abstract: 本发明公开了一种用户上线方法,包括:用户管理设备接收第一BNG上报的用户的第一上线报文,该报文携带有用户的用户信息和第一BNG的信息;还接收第二BNG上报的所述用户的第二上线报文,该报文携带有用户的用户信息和第二BNG的信息;根据所述用户信息在所述用户所属的BNG列表中记录第一BNG的信息和第二BNG的信息;按预定策略从所述BNG列表中选择所述第一BNG;将所述用户的转发信息下发给所述第一BNG;向所述用户发送应答报文,用于通知所述用户通过所述第一BNG上线,还公开了一种用户管理设备、BNG及用户上线系统。本发明通过独立的用户管理设备对BNG用户上线进行管理,使得用户规模可以灵活扩展。

    策略冲突解决方法以及装置

    公开(公告)号:CN104104615A

    公开(公告)日:2014-10-15

    申请号:CN201410348832.2

    申请日:2014-07-21

    Abstract: 本申请公开了一种策略冲突解决方法以及装置。所述方法包括:接收第一控制策略并将所述第一控制策略分解成m条第一规则,以及,接收第二控制策略并将所述第二控制策略分解成n条第二规则;对每条所述第一规则取反以得到第一反规则,对每条所述第二规则取反以得到第二反规则,分别将每条所述第一反规则与每条所述第二反规则按照规则合成原则生成相应的第一执行规则;删除所述无效规则,并将剩余的所述第一执行规则作为有效第一执行规则,将每条所述有效第一执行规则取反后根据所述第一转发设备支持的协议转化为所述第一转发设备相应的转发表项。通过上述方式,能够解决策略冲突。

    数据包的处理方法和装置
    79.
    发明公开

    公开(公告)号:CN103647718A

    公开(公告)日:2014-03-19

    申请号:CN201310687011.7

    申请日:2013-12-13

    Abstract: 本发明实施例提供一种数据包的处理方法和装置。该方法包括:接收数据包;查询单域单表,获取与该数据包中的信息对应的匹配域的值;根据该匹配域的值对应的索引,查询规则表,获取与该匹配域的值对应的索引所在的表项对应的匹配规则;根据该匹配规则,对该数据包执行相应的处理。本发明实施例的数据包的处理方法和装置解决现有技术中查找速度较慢,从而导致了数据包的处理速度较慢问题。

    一种报文处理方法及相关设备

    公开(公告)号:CN102301663A

    公开(公告)日:2011-12-28

    申请号:CN201180001146.2

    申请日:2011-07-06

    Inventor: 林程勇

    CPC classification number: H04L12/4633 H04L45/66 H04L45/74 H04L47/10 H04L47/12

    Abstract: 本发明实施例公开了一种报文处理方法及相关设备,其中,一种报文处理方法包括:第一网络设备接收转发报文;对所述转发报文进行流表匹配,若不匹配,则,将所述转发报文封装上远端隧道内层封装和远端隧道外层封装后,发送给第二网络设备,以便所述第二网络设备将所述转发报文转发给控制服务器处理;接收所述第二网络设备返回的流表报文,所述流表报文中携带所述转发报文的流表信息,且封装有特殊二层帧头;依据所述特殊二层帧头中的以太类型值所指示的操作,对所述流表报文进行处理。本发明提供的技术方案能有效解决网络设备控制平面的瓶颈限制问题,同时实现数据转发和路由控制的分离。

Patent Agency Ranking